An Aragog of Their Very Own
According to the Belfast Telegraph, Northern Ireland's only volunteer wildlife ambulance and advice service has been inundated with calls from parents seeking information about where to purchase owls, snakes and spiders as Christmas presents.

"Chamber of Secrets" Game Takes Top Spot
Hoover's Online is reporting that "Chamber of Secrets" is number one on NPD's PC game sales chart for the week of November 17-23.
